Typically most companies have been using supervised learning with human labeled dataset. However, thirst for more labels is never satisfied, especially for deep learning models. In this talk, Karthik will talk about technologies to overcome lack of abundance of human labeled dataset with specific examples in computer vision and NLP domains. The talk will explain how synthetic dataset can be used to train a model that can be generalized to operate on real world data. Then, Karthik will cover self-supervised learning that is becoming an emerging trend in large scale deep learning tasks. The talk will focus on a couple of use cases of self-supervised learning techniques that are general enough to be applicable in the majority of computer vision tasks.
